Finance Review Summary — Finance Team

The Alderpoint satellite office will close at the end of Q2. Lease termination costs total 38k, offset by 71k in annualized savings. Four staff relocate to the Grenhall site; two roles are eliminated with standard severance. Equipment disposal is handled by facilities. Final reconciliation is due in July. The closure also connects to a broader plan.

management briefing: The renewal with Zoraelax Group closes at $10 million a year, 15 percent below the last contract. Project Ralael slips by six weeks because of the audit delay.

Capacity note — Lattermill Relay. WebSocket compression (permessage-deflate) cuts bandwidth roughly 60% on our chatty feeds, but each compressed connection holds a zlib context, so memory per socket triples. Above 40k connections per node, CPU for deflate becomes the bottleneck before NICs do. We split the difference with these settings, which you should not change without a load test:

tuning table, faduf-baduf:
PRIORITIES = {
    "ulavan": 191,
    "silys": 750,
    "goriel": 238,
    "kelmir": 66,
    "wendor": 432,
}

**Handover Note — Joint Venture with Tarnwick Instruments**

Elena, here's where things stand before I head off. The Tarnwick folks are keen but want a 40/60 equity split, which the board hasn't fully digested yet. Draft term sheet is in the shared folder; legal flagged two clauses on IP ownership. Push them gently on governance seats — they'll bend. One last thing the board needs to see before signing anything is set out just below.

internal memo for hafog-hadug: The pricing group signed off on a budget of $16.1 million for Project Gorir. The renewal with Oliionax Systems closes at $14.1 million a year, 46 percent above the last contract.

During fire drills at Penhallow Court, the facilities desk coordinates the roll call at the north assembly point. Visitors must be escorted out by their hosts and counted against the day's sign-in sheet, which the desk officer carries on the clipboard from reception. Anyone unaccounted for must be reported to the drill marshal immediately. After the all-clear, re-entry is through the side lobby only, as the main turnstiles remain disabled for ten minutes. To unlock the side lobby door, enter the code below.

staff pass of kawip-hawef = bdg-QLP-2